Wood Barn Siding Installation Questions
What types of wood are suitable for barn siding? Common options include cedar, pine, and redwood, each offering durability and attractive appearance for barn siding projects.
Is barn siding installation suitable for historic properties? Yes, barn siding can enhance the character of historic properties when properly installed and maintained.
What should property owners consider before installing wood barn siding? Factors include the property's style, climate conditions, and the desired aesthetic to ensure proper material choice and installation.
Can barn siding be used for other exterior features? Yes, wood barn siding can be applied to accents, fencing, or additional exterior elements to complement a property’s design.
